Output 990e1063f072c3856e513e78ba020bebf08b861ff8fdf091ab7294b7b611c325:0

value
578836496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37f4d03dca3605810ded6ea80c9483cf5c4be54f OP_EQUALVERIFY OP_CHECKSIG
address
Y58KFrC4vP64zwQSXjfyPChbtvfGNSpD3Y
transaction
990e1063f072c3856e513e78ba020bebf08b861ff8fdf091ab7294b7b611c325